				<p><a href="/post/3354/the-artist-is-present/">The artist is present</a></p>
				<p>Managed to catch this exhibition in the MOMA in NY last month. </p>
<p>We were all quite taken with Marina Abramovich and her approach to 'her art'.  Alongside the main exhibit was a retrospective of her work. Seems for anyone unaware of who she is that all of the work she has done features her, either photographically or filmically, and tends to have her pushing boundaries - big time.  </p>
<p>Whether it is pain threshold, nudity or sanity boudaries as a spectator these exhibits are weirdly compelling.</p>
<p>Not exactly what you expect to see on an afternoon at the art gallery though ;)</p>
<p>Definitely recommend it if it comes to a gallery near you.<br /></p>			</div>

				<p><a href="/post/661/hungry/">hungry...?</a></p>
				<p>Take a look at my new favourite brand.  I came across them when Niki a friend of mine sent me the details (she knows I love to eat fresh fruit and 'birdfood' as Adrian and Bri call it).  </p>
<p>Anyway, you go to the site <a href="http://www.graze.com/">www.graze.com</a> and you select what type of lunch you want, so could be protein rich if you are training, or a calorie controlled one if you are trying to lose weight or you can just go for nutritionally balanced, there are loads of options.  Once you have chosen the type then you go through a bit which works out what type of food you like, and then you're all set to book your lunch.  They make up a lunch box of fresh fruit, olives, nuts, chocolate, whatever and it arrives by first class post on the days you have requested. </p>
<p> It's great, every time a total surprise lunch that someone else has handpicked from things they know you like.  </p>
<p>The reason I wanted to blog it here though is that the packaging is beautiful.  The whole experience with them in my eyes is bang on with the marketing, their approach, brand personality, packaging design, web, all of it.  </p>
